/*
 * LOCALE_EXTRACT_BATCH_SIZE
 *
 * Controls how many source files the Lingowell extraction script
 * scans per batch when harvesting translatable strings. Larger
 * values speed up full extraction runs but risk memory pressure
 * on the release runners; 200 has been stable since the Q3 rework.
 *
 * For the release manager: do not change this mid-cycle, since
 * partial extraction runs can silently drop strings from the
 * handoff bundle. The extraction artifact this constant was last
 * validated against is recorded below.
 */

session token of kageg-tahop = htk14_af3c1ccccb7dcf

## Service account: crumbline-cutoff

This service account enforces the Crumbline bakery order-cutoff rule: custom cake orders close at 14:00 the day before pickup. The account flips order forms to read-only and emails the kitchen a final tally. It has no access to payment records. To run the cutoff job locally, use the internal API key listed directly below.

API key for fawip-baduf: vxb7-sLUoG4g

## Vendoring Third-Party Fonts — Approvals

Quick reminder for release managers: any font bundled into a Brightquill build needs a license check before it lands in the vendored assets folder. Yes, even the "free" ones — we got burned on the Marrowtype incident. File the request, attach the license text, and wait for the green light. All vendoring approvals go through the person below.

approver of tagef-hawef = Oliok Julath

Subject: Key rotation — Wavelet preview service

Team,

We rotated the credentials for Wavelet, the internal service that renders audio waveform previews in the Soundframe editor. Old keys stop working Friday. New hires: Wavelet auth is required for any local build that touches the preview pane, so update your env file today. Docs for setup live on the Soundframe wiki under Previews. No other services are affected by this rotation. The new shared key follows.

service key, fawip-bajef: kto11_Qt5wZK9vdNC